Get started54 Railway Street is a four-bedroom detached house in Barnetby (DN38 6DQ). It has a recorded floor area of 146 m² (around 1572 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1967-1975 and council tax band E. The latest certificate (April 2018) shows a D (score 62),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. When first surveyed in February 2009 the rating was E,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, wall efficiency went from Poor to Average, roof efficiency went from Poor to Very Good and window efficiency went from Poor to Good; while lighting dropped from Very Good to Good.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 81), a 2-band jump.
Sale prices here have outpaced England HPI: 5.4%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£425,000 is 18.1% above the 2020 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£229/sq ft) was about 75.5%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Most recent transfer: December 2020 at £360,000. Across the public record there are 4 sales, relatively high churn for a single property. One planning record on file: an extension approved in 2023. Past consents include an extension and a porch,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. At 146 m² it's 26.4% larger than the typical home in the postcode (116 m² median across 10 EPCs).
